  • Patent number: 11293516
    Abstract: A hydraulic damper includes a cylinder containing a hydraulic fluid and a piston affixed to a piston rod that extends out from one end of the cylinder through an end cap seal and that divides the cylinder into two chambers. The piston includes a port extending longitudinally through it where the port defines a valve seat. Inserted in the port is a spring-loaded valve member having a central bore extending longitudinally through it of a selected diameter that sets the rate of extension and return of the piston rod during use.

  • Patent number: 10654420
    Abstract: A ladder rack assembly for a work vehicle has a stationary bed for attachment to the roof thereof. A pair of parallel, spaced apart rails has guides thereon that extend from the rails' first ends toward, but short their second ends. Rollers on side edges of a load support member ride on the bed rails. When the rollers are constrained by the guides, only translation of the load support member takes place. Upon exit of the rollers from the rear ends of the guides, both translation and rotation of the load support member can occur. A control arm is pivotally joined at one end to the stationary bed. Its free end has cam actuated latch pin assemblies attached to it that co-act with cams on the stationary bed during rearward displacement of the load support member to latch the load support member to the control arm whereby further rearward movement of the load support member causes it to tilt to a somewhat vertical position.

  • Patent number: 10578182
    Abstract: Housing has first and second parallel tubular chambers. The first chamber contains a gas spring whose output shaft connects to a first piston of area A1. The second chamber contains a second piston of area A2<A1. Piston A2 connects to the device's output shaft. The housing has a valve block with an internal port in fluid communication with the two chambers between the first and second pistons. The valve block contains an incompressible fluid. A poppet valve is in the internal port. The poppet includes a flow restricting bore therethrough. A force on the output shaft causes the fluid to force open the poppet and displace the piston, A1, storing energy in the gas spring. Upon removal of the force on the device's output shaft, the gas spring pushes the fluid to close the poppet. Hence, only a low volume flow through the bore in the poppet is permitted.

  • Patent number: 10501022
    Abstract: A ladder latching device for a tilting ladder rack includes an inner extrusion for clamping to the load supporting member of the ladder rack. An outer extrusion is slidably mounted on the inner extrusion. The outer extrusion carries a treadle and ladder rung engaging stop. Between the two extrusions are a toothed rack and a gas spring. The outer extrusion carries a pivotable, spring-biased lever having a tooth for selectively engaging the toothed rack for releasably locking the stop at a desired location relative to a rung of a ladder being unloaded as the outer extrusion is made to slide by applying foot pressure on the treadle. Thus, a ladder may be lowered along the load supporting member until the ladder's feet engage the ground as the stop disengages from its place on a ladder rung.

  • Patent number: 10470565
    Abstract: A shelving unit adapted for attachment to a vertical surface has a plurality of square cross-section tubes that are to be attached vertically the surface. The tubes have slots arranged in horizontal pairs in vertically spaced relation along the length of the tubes. Fitted into the slots are L-shaped steel plates having first and second legs. The first legs are pivotally mounted within the tubes to swing through the slots. A stop is provided causing the second leg to extend perpendicularly to a front side of the square tubes. Sandwiched between the second legs of each adjacent pair of plates are shelf supports for rectangular shelves. The pivotal mount of the plate pairs allows a shelf to be shifted from a horizontal and vertical disposition. Spring latches attached to the tubes serve to releasably secure the shelves in their vertical disposition.

  • Patent number: 10466721
    Abstract: A control system for controlling a drive motor operating a discharge valve installed in a conduit on a firefighting vehicle. The system includes a pressure sensor configured to measure a pressure of liquids flowing through the conduit, a flow sensor configured to measure a flow rate of liquids flowing through the conduit, a variable control switch operable to generate a variable control signal in response to manual activation, and a microcontroller operable to receive the pressure and flow rate, and generate a variable non-linear control signal operable to cause the drive motor to change the position of the discharge valve at a variable non-linear speed directly proportional to a distance of a current setting from a desired setting.

  • Patent number: 9829895
    Abstract: A fire truck operable to automatically refill a water tank comprises a first pressure transducer coupled to an intake inlet of the pump and operable to measure an intake pressure, a second pressure transducer coupled to a discharge outlet of the pump and operable to measure a discharge pressure, a first discharge pipe coupled between the discharge outlet of the pump and a fire hose, a second discharge pipe coupled between the discharge outlet of the pump and the water tank, a control valve disposed in the second discharge pipe, and a controller operable to automatically sense a low water level condition of the tank, and automatically control the engine speed, the pump speed, and the control valve so that adequate water supply to the fire hose via the first discharge pipe is automatically given priority and maintained while automatically refilling the water tank via the second discharge pipe.

  • Patent number: 9625915
    Abstract: A control system comprises a central controller adapted to receive user input and commands, and in communication with a plurality of remote sensors adapted to detect various vehicular parameters: water pressure, water level, water flow rate, engine speed, pump speed, etc., and firefighter parameters: air tank level, air flow rate, body temperature, respiration rate, O2 saturation level, ambient temperature, and presence of hazardous chemicals and radiation. The system further comprises a plurality of remote actuators adapted to receive commands from the central controller and automatically carry out an operation in response to the received command. A wireless communication subsystem is adapted to receive and transmit sensed parameters from the plurality of remote sensors to the central controller, and transmit user input and commands from the central controller to the plurality of remote actuators. A central display screen is adapted to present sensed parameters and warnings.
